Transaction cf14fe77c65878799b5e2693f504961d10e1ab806cfa2f0ed3477da7b76984b5
1 Input
1 Output
-
cf14fe77c65878799b5e2693f504961d10e1ab806cfa2f0ed3477da7b76984b5:0
- value
- 553356
- script pubkey
- OP_0 OP_PUSHBYTES_20 577314340aaff17591f83fdf5169580378026b6d
- address
- bc1q2ae3gdq24lchty0c8l04z62cqduqy6mdwu9whe